新聞中心

EEPW首頁 > 嵌入式系統(tǒng) > 設(shè)計(jì)應(yīng)用 > 應(yīng)用現(xiàn)場總線和伺服控制實(shí)現(xiàn)裁斷精度的控制系統(tǒng)

應(yīng)用現(xiàn)場總線和伺服控制實(shí)現(xiàn)裁斷精度的控制系統(tǒng)

作者: 時(shí)間:2016-12-19 來源:網(wǎng)絡(luò) 收藏

  軟件設(shè)計(jì)及分析
  本系統(tǒng)軟件設(shè)計(jì)主要包括三大部分:
  l plc控制程序和plc 和位置控制器clm的通信程序的設(shè)計(jì),其中包括系統(tǒng) profibus-dp網(wǎng)絡(luò)組態(tài)、系統(tǒng)硬件組態(tài)、控制程序設(shè)計(jì)等;
  l 力士樂位置控制器裁斷伺服控制程序;
  l 監(jiān)控程序的設(shè)計(jì),主要包括系統(tǒng)運(yùn)行需要的監(jiān)控主界面、裁斷控制界面、報(bào)表生成和數(shù)據(jù)查詢界面等人機(jī)界面的設(shè)計(jì)。
  plc控制程序設(shè)計(jì)
  系統(tǒng)中以西門子s7-315-2dp作為profibus現(xiàn)場總線主站提供與力士樂位置控制器clm直接而便利的高速循環(huán)通信服務(wù),通訊速率高、控制適時(shí)性好、抗干擾能力強(qiáng)且編程簡單。在plc編程軟件step7中導(dǎo)入位置控制器clm設(shè)備數(shù)據(jù)庫文件(in2_04eb.gsd),完成硬件網(wǎng)絡(luò)組態(tài),為位置控制器分配網(wǎng)絡(luò)地址,該地址必須與控制器參數(shù)中設(shè)置的相同,在組織塊ob中選用sfc14“dprd_dat”,sfc15“dpwr_ dat”系統(tǒng)功能塊向位置控制器接收/發(fā)送過程數(shù)據(jù)。
  在位置控制器參數(shù)b007中設(shè)置與主站的總線通訊率,參數(shù)b008中設(shè)置從站網(wǎng)絡(luò)地址,并選擇參數(shù)過程數(shù)據(jù)對(duì)象(ppo)類型,這樣系統(tǒng)的現(xiàn)場設(shè)備與plc之間通過profibus-dp總線可以完成數(shù)據(jù)的讀寫和控制數(shù)據(jù)的傳輸,如控制字、狀態(tài)字、給定值和實(shí)際值等。除過程數(shù)據(jù)外,profibus-dp也傳輸傳動(dòng)系統(tǒng)的參數(shù)設(shè)置和診斷信號(hào)。
  plc根據(jù)聯(lián)動(dòng)線的運(yùn)行速度、操作指令及裁斷裝置的狀態(tài)對(duì)皮帶、刀架進(jìn)行協(xié)調(diào)控制。胎面在兩條運(yùn)輸帶之間的貯存量使傳感器產(chǎn)生相應(yīng)模擬量輸出信號(hào),并與前段運(yùn)輸帶的速度綜合起來按照一定的算法決定裁斷皮帶的運(yùn)行速度,從而通過plc相應(yīng)地改變速度使運(yùn)輸帶協(xié)調(diào)平穩(wěn)運(yùn)行。用戶根據(jù)產(chǎn)品生產(chǎn)需要相應(yīng)設(shè)置胎面裁斷長度等參數(shù),通過總線完成plc與位置控制器之間的數(shù)據(jù)傳輸。
  位置控制器clm的伺服程序設(shè)計(jì)
  力士樂位置控制器clm是一種緊湊型、模塊化二/四軸數(shù)控系統(tǒng),直接驅(qū)動(dòng)力士樂dkc伺服驅(qū)動(dòng)器完成交流伺服電機(jī)的精確定位運(yùn)行,本系統(tǒng)中二套力士樂dkc伺服驅(qū)動(dòng)器分別完成傳送帶定長傳送和裁斷刀架橫移的控制。位置控制器帶有豐富的指令集,可在其操作面板或裝有編程軟件(motionmanger)的計(jì)算機(jī)上完成控制程序的編寫。
  裁斷伺服控制程序框圖如圖3所示,程序主要由總線通訊、傳送皮帶控制和裁斷刀架控制三部分組成。控制器與plc之間控制和狀態(tài)信息的傳送由總線通訊程序完成,控制器接收plc傳送的控制信息如速度值、長度值和操作指令等,同時(shí)將運(yùn)行狀態(tài)信息傳送給plc進(jìn)行分析、顯示;傳送帶控制程序完成傳送帶伺服電機(jī)運(yùn)行的速度和位置控制,進(jìn)行胎面裁斷的精確定長和平穩(wěn)快速運(yùn)行;裁斷刀架控制程序完成裁斷刀架橫向移動(dòng)切割和其輔助裝置的控制,保證裁刀動(dòng)作的正常執(zhí)行,得到較好的切割端面。

本文引用地址:http://butianyuan.cn/article/201612/331236.htm

圖3 伺服控制程序框圖

  監(jiān)控系統(tǒng)設(shè)計(jì)
  系統(tǒng)以plc為第一主站和以工業(yè)pc為第二主站,其中工業(yè)pc作為上位機(jī),提供良好的人機(jī)交互環(huán)境,實(shí)現(xiàn)對(duì)整條生產(chǎn)線的生產(chǎn)管理和監(jiān)控,并實(shí)現(xiàn)連接到車間級(jí)intranet網(wǎng)絡(luò)。第一主站(主控plc)是整個(gè)胎面生產(chǎn)線控制系統(tǒng)的核心,實(shí)現(xiàn)生產(chǎn)過程數(shù)據(jù)的采集和處理,以及控制信號(hào)的發(fā)送與工業(yè)pc的通訊,以便于操作人員監(jiān)控現(xiàn)場的設(shè)備。整個(gè)系統(tǒng)的操作、工作狀態(tài)及測量分析結(jié)果在工業(yè)pc上進(jìn)行圖形顯示監(jiān)控,通過現(xiàn)場總線由plc上傳相關(guān)數(shù)據(jù)信息,處理系統(tǒng)報(bào)警,存儲(chǔ)歷史數(shù)據(jù),生成各類報(bào)表,并進(jìn)行圖形顯示及人機(jī)對(duì)話,向plc下傳相關(guān)控制命令,從而實(shí)現(xiàn)監(jiān)控計(jì)算機(jī)與現(xiàn)場設(shè)備之間的信息管理。
  裁斷控制人機(jī)界面采用tp270觸摸屏,通過profibus總線與plc主機(jī)連接。對(duì)于觸摸屏的編程,采用西門子公司提供的protool/procs組態(tài)軟件進(jìn)行編程組態(tài)。protool/procs完整的圖形用戶界面加上軟件本身自帶的項(xiàng)目組態(tài)向?qū)г试S用戶方便地創(chuàng)建面向?qū)ο蟆⒒诜?hào)的各種項(xiàng)目。在protool/procs中界面上的操作單元與執(zhí)行器之間通過plc利用變量進(jìn)行通訊,即在hmi可以直接讀或?qū)懙膒lc上的存儲(chǔ)地址。軟件設(shè)計(jì)思想是在完成基本人機(jī)交互功能的基礎(chǔ)上,設(shè)計(jì)了一套讓操作者能夠自學(xué)習(xí)操作規(guī)程的軟件系統(tǒng)。通過人機(jī)界面,操作者即能設(shè)置一些基本的參數(shù),如定長值、誤差調(diào)整、裁斷次數(shù)等,也可以監(jiān)測系統(tǒng)的報(bào)警狀態(tài),學(xué)習(xí)系統(tǒng)的操作規(guī)范以及密碼設(shè)置等。自動(dòng)運(yùn)行按照設(shè)備設(shè)計(jì)的動(dòng)作流程進(jìn)行自動(dòng)運(yùn)行控制時(shí),一些需要調(diào)整的參數(shù),如速度、位置等可以方便的在觸摸屏上進(jìn)行調(diào)整、修定。異常停止當(dāng)定位模塊、伺服驅(qū)動(dòng)器、行程開關(guān)以及機(jī)器異常時(shí)伺服馬達(dá)都應(yīng)該立即停止運(yùn)轉(zhuǎn),并產(chǎn)生異常碼顯示在觸摸屏上,以便維修人員及時(shí)了解發(fā)生的問題。
  結(jié)語
  本控制系統(tǒng)充分利用了plc、profibus現(xiàn)場總線技術(shù)和伺服控制等先進(jìn)技術(shù),系統(tǒng)采用分布式開放結(jié)構(gòu),響應(yīng)速度快,組態(tài)靈活,控制功能完善,操作簡單規(guī)范。定長裁斷系統(tǒng)設(shè)計(jì)完成后已在多家全鋼子午輪胎生產(chǎn)線中投入使用,控制精度達(dá)到±1mm,實(shí)踐證明該套基于profibus-dp現(xiàn)場總線的控制系統(tǒng)安全可靠,故障率低,產(chǎn)品完全滿足下道工序的高標(biāo)準(zhǔn)要求,具有較高的生產(chǎn)和管理自動(dòng)化水平,提高了生產(chǎn)效率,創(chuàng)造了較好的經(jīng)濟(jì)效益。


上一頁 1 2 下一頁

評(píng)論


技術(shù)專區(qū)

關(guān)閉